Mary Astell (1916) is a book written by Florence Mary Smith that provides a comprehensive biography of Mary Astell, an influential English writer and philosopher of the late 17th and early 18th centuries. The book covers Astell's life from her birth in 1666 to her death in 1731, and explores her contributions to the fields of theology, philosophy, and women's rights. Smith delves into Astell's upbringing, education, and relationships, as well as her major works such as A Serious Proposal to the Ladies and Reflections upon Marriage. The book also examines Astell's role in the intellectual circles of her time and her influence on later feminist thinkers.
